How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Elton?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Elton Studio Apartments | $857 | $500 | $1,149 |
Elton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,063 | $575 | $2,870 |
Elton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,181 | $669 | $3,250 |
Elton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,073 | $875 | $1,299 |

Largest Available Elton and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ments
The largest available 3 Bedroom apartment unit in Elton, WI is found at Bos Creek Estates in the Downtown Wausau neighborhood and is 1,300 square feet priced from $1,299. SCS Fox Point has the second largest 3 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,165 square feet and currently listed start at $1,585. Here is today’s list of the largest available 3 Bedroom units in Elton:
Apartment Listing | Model Name | Square Footage | Priced From |
---|---|---|---|
Bos Creek Estates | 3 Bed 1.5 Bath Upper | 1,300 Sq Ft | $1,299 |
SCS Fox Point | Fulton 3 BR Upper | 1,165 Sq Ft | $1,585 |
SCS Shawano | Fulton 3 BR Lower | 1,092 Sq Ft | $1,465 |
Aspen Village | 3 Bed, 1.5 Bath Townhome | 988 Sq Ft | $1,015 |
Cheapest Available Elton and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ments
As of May 12, 2025 the lowest priced 3 Bedroom apartment unit in Elton, WI is the 3 Bed, 1.5 Bath Townhome Model starting from $1,015 at Aspen Village . The second most affordable Elton 3 Bedroom is the 3 Bed 1.5 Bath Upper Model at Bos Creek Estates starting at $1,299 in the Downtown Wausau neighborhood. The average price for all 3 Bedroom apartments in Elton is currently $1,073.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 3 Bedroom options in Elton:
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
---|---|---|
Aspen Village | 3 Bed, 1.5 Bath Townhome | $1,015 |
Bos Creek Estates | 3 Bed 1.5 Bath Upper | $1,299 |
SCS Shawano | Fulton 3 BR Lower | $1,465 |
SCS Fox Point | Fulton 3 BR Upper | $1,585 |
